Debian: DSA-4167-1 Critical: Sharutils Buffer Overflow Security Advisory

A buffer-overflow vulnerability was discovered in Sharutils, a set of utilities handle Shell Archives. An attacker with control on the input of the unshar command, could crash the application or execute arbitrary code in the its context. . - ------------------------------------------------------------------------- Debian Security Advisory DSA-4167-1 This email address is being protected from spambots. You need JavaScript enabled to view it. https://www.debian.org/security/ Luciano Bello April 05, 2018 https://www.debian.org/security/faq - ------------------------------------------------------------------------- Package : sharutils CVE ID : CVE-2018-1000097 Debian Bug : 893525 A buffer-overflow vulnerability was discovered in Sharutils, a set of utilities handle Shell Archives. An attacker with control on the input of the unshar command, could crash the application or execute arbitrary code in the its context. For the oldstable distribution (jessie), this problem has been fixed in version 4.14-2+deb8u1. For the stable distribution (stretch), this problem has been fixed in version 1:4.15.2-2+deb9u1. We recommend that you upgrade your sharutils packages. Fedora 27: 2018-03-06 Severe Heap Overflow In Sharutils Unshar

This release fixes a heap buffer overflow when processing a shar archive by unshar tool if the arhive contains overlong lines.. --------------------------------------------------------------------------------Fedora Update Notification FEDORA-2018-8f4b3fa844 2018-03-06 17:17:51.856083 --------------------------------------------------------------------------------Name : sharutils Product : Fedora 27 Version : 4.15.2 Release : 8.fc27 URL : http://www.gnu.org/software/sharutils/ Summary : The GNU shar utilities for packaging and unpackaging shell archives Description : The sharutils package contains the GNU shar utilities, a set of tools for encoding and decoding packages of files (in binary or text format) in a special plain text format called shell archives (shar). This format can be sent through e-mail (which can be problematic for regular binary files). The shar utility supports a wide range of capabilities (compressing, uuencoding, splitting long files for multi-part mailings, providing check-sums), which make it very flexible at creating shar files. After the files have been sent, the unshar tool scans mail messages looking for shar files. Unshar automatically strips off mail headers and introductory text and then unpacks the shar files. --------------------------------------------------------------------------------Update Information: This release fixes a heap buffer overflow when processing a shar archive by unshar tool if the arhive contains overlong lines. --------------------------------------------------------------------------------References: [ 1 ] Bug #1548018 - sharutils: heap-buffer-overflow in find_archive in unshar.c https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1548018 --------------------------------------------------------------------------------This update can be installed with the "dnf" update program. Red Hat: RHSA-2005:378-01 Moderate: Sharutils Buffer Overflow Risk

An updated sharutils package is now available. This update has been rated as having low security impact by the Red Hat Security Response Team.. - --------------------------------------------------------------------- Red Hat Security Advisory Synopsis: Low: sharutils security update Advisory ID: RHSA-2005:377-01 Advisory URL: https://access.redhat.com/errata/RHSA-2005:377.html Issue date: 2005-04-26 Updated on: 2005-04-26 Product: Red Hat Enterprise Linux CVE Names: CAN-2004-1772 CAN-2004-1773 CAN-2005-0990 - ---------------------------------------------------------------------1. Summary: An updated sharutils package is now available. This update has been rated as having low security impact by the Red Hat Security Response Team. 2. Problem description: The sharutils package contains a set of tools for encoding and decoding packages of files in binary or text format. A stack based overflow bug was found in the way shar handles the -o option. If a user can be tricked into running a specially crafted command, it could lead to arbitrary code execution. The Common Vulnerabilities and Exposures project (cve.mitre.org) has assigned the name CAN-2004-1772 to this issue. Please note that this issue does not affect Red Hat Enterprise Linux 4. Two buffer overflow bugs were found in sharutils. If an attacker can place a malicious 'wc' command on a victim's machine, or trick a victim into running a specially crafted command, it could lead to arbitrary code execution. The Common Vulnerabilities and Exposures project (cve.mitre.org) has assigned the name CAN-2004-1773 to this issue. A bug was found in the way unshar creates temporary files. A local user could use symlinks to overwrite arbitrary files the victim running unshar has write access to. The Common Vulnerabilities and Exposures project (cve.mitre.org) has assigned the name CAN-2005-0990 to this issue. All users of sharutils should upgrade to thisupdated package, which includes backported fixes to correct these issues. 3.
